Although they took their name from a song penned by their in-state stoned doom heroes the Obsessed, Rockville, MD, natives Indestroy performed a savage brand of thrash bordering on death metal. Formed in 1983, Indestroy worked their way toward a 1986 demo and, by the release of their eponymous debut album through New Renaissance Records the following year, consisted of vocalist/guitarist Mark Strassburg, bassist Jeff Parsons, guitarist Drew Adrian, and drummer Gus Basilika.
